The hygiene products segment is one of the largest consumers of absorbent polymers, especially in the production of disposable diapers, adult incontinence products, and feminine hygiene products. Disposable diapers are the most common application of absorbent polymers, where the superabsorbent polymers (SAPs) play a crucial role in ensuring the product's effectiveness in moisture management. SAPs are designed to absorb and retain liquid, preventing leakage and skin irritation while maintaining dryness. In adult incontinence products, SAPs are essential to ensure comfort and reliability, supporting the needs of an aging population. Feminine hygiene products, including sanitary napkins and tampons, also use absorbent polymers to ensure that the products remain highly absorbent, lightweight, and efficient.

The agriculture sector is another important application for absorbent polymers, where they are used to improve water retention in soil, increase crop yields, and reduce the impact of drought conditions. Hydrogels, a type of absorbent polymer, are widely used to enhance soil moisture retention by absorbing water and gradually releasing it to plant roots. This helps farmers optimize water usage, reduce irrigation costs, and improve the overall health and growth of crops, especially in regions facing water scarcity. Aside from hygiene and agriculture, absorbent polymers find applications in various other industries. These include applications in the construction sector, where superabsorbent polymers are used in concrete mixtures to improve workability and moisture retention. The polymers help in reducing the overall water requirement for concrete mixing, which can improve the setting time and prevent cracks. Additionally, absorbent polymers are utilized in environmental management applications, such as in oil spill cleanup operations, where they are used to absorb and contain oil and other hazardous substances. In packaging, absorbent polymers can be incorporated into food packaging materials to help preserve freshness by controlling moisture levels.

1. What are absorbent polymers?
Absorbent polymers are materials capable of absorbing and retaining large amounts of water or fluids, often used in hygiene, agriculture, and other applications.
2. How do absorbent polymers work in diapers?
In diapers, absorbent polymers, known as superabsorbent polymers (SAPs), absorb liquid and transform it into a gel, preventing leaks and keeping the skin dry.
